**About the Train**
The Royal Scotsman rekindles the romance of rail travel. Departing from Edinburgh, this luxurious train offers 2- to 4-night journeys around the Scottish Highlands. Just 40 guests are accommodated in 10 sumptuous, Edwardian-style carriages. Rich in Scottish craftsmanship and têxtiles, they conjure up an intimate, country-house atmosphere. Fine dining is an important part of the experience, with the Executive Chef and team creating exquisite feasts based on local specialities. The train’s bar boasts over 60 whiskies, as well as fine wines and other local specialities, including the train’s own gin. Guests also enjoy one of the most unique spas in Scotland: the Bamford Haybarn Spa, a carriage transformed into a light, airy treatment space offering botanically inspired therapies.
Off-train adventures enhance every journey and include private visits to laird’s castles, whisky distilleries and wildlife-rich estates. Guests can also customise their trip with a range of activities, from wild swimming and kayaking to stargazing and golf. Evenings are rounded off with exhilarating onboard entertainment, such as Scottish storytelling or a lively ceilidh. Everything about our train is extraordinary - and we want you to be, too.
**About Belmond**
Belmond is part of the world’s leading luxury group, LVMH Moët Hennessy Louis Vuitton.
Belmond has been a pioneer of exceptional luxury travel since 1976. Its portfolio extends across 24 countries with 46 remarkable properties that include the illustrious Venice Simplon-Orient-Express train, remote beach retreats like Cap Juluca in Anguilla, Italian hideaways such as Splendido in Portofino, and gateways to natural wonders such as Hotel das Cataratas beside Brazil’s Iguassu Falls. From trains to river barges, safari lodges to hotels, each unique property has a distinctive story, personality and identity, with a personalised team to match.
The essence of the Belmond brand is built upon its heritage, craftsmanship and genuine, authentic service. We treasure history while looking to the future. We embrace community spirit and believe in responsible, sustainable tourism. As part of our Think Global, Act Local approach, we prioritise purchasing food from sustainable sources, run and support educational programmes and follow sustainable practices to reduce our impact on the environment.
